Artist Profile

Dua Lipa is a London-born solo pop artist known for shimmering disco, house, and synth-pop anthems. She rose to fame with New Rules in 2017, built global momentum with her debut album, and cemented her status through Future Nostalgia (2020) and Radical Optimism (2024). Born to Kosovar-Albanian parents, she began posting covers online as a teen, trained her distinctive lower register, and signed to Warner Records. Today she headlines arenas and stadiums worldwide and co-writes most of her catalog.

Awards and Accolades

Major honors include three Grammys: Best New Artist (2019), Best Dance Recording for Electricity with Silk City (2019), and Best Pop Vocal Album for Future Nostalgia (2021), plus multiple additional Grammy nominations across Record, Song, and Album of the Year. She holds multiple BRIT Awards, including British Female Solo Artist (2018, 2021), British Breakthrough Act (2018), British Single for One Kiss with Calvin Harris (2019), British Album of the Year for Future Nostalgia (2021), and Pop Act (2024). She also won the 2022 Billboard Music Award for Top Radio Song with Levitating.

Collaborators and Labels

Dua’s collaborators span Calvin Harris, Silk City (Mark Ronson and Diplo), Elton John, Miley Cyrus, Sean Paul, and Martin Garrix, while producers include Ian Kirkpatrick, Koz, Stuart Price, The Monsters & Strangerz, Andrew Watt, Kevin Parker, and Danny L Harle. She releases music through Warner Records and routinely partners with remixers like The Blessed Madonna to reimagine her sound for clubs worldwide.

How long is the concert?

Arena shows often list a start time of 7:30 PM in the U.S. and Canada, while many Latin American stadium dates begin at 8:00–9:00 PM. Doors typically open 60–90 minutes earlier. If there is an opener, expect 30–45 minutes, a short changeover, and then Dua Lipa’s headlining set of roughly 90–110 minutes. Exact run times vary by venue and local curfew, so always rely on your ticket and pre‑show email for the most current timeline.

Can I bring a bag, camera, or food?

Most arenas use a clear‑bag policy: clear bags up to roughly 12″×6″×12″ or small clutches about the size of a hand; rules vary by venue. Professional cameras, detachable lenses, audio recorders, tripods, and selfie sticks are typically prohibited; personal phones are fine. Outside food and drink are usually not allowed, except for medical needs or baby items; sealed water policies differ. Many venues are cashless, so bring a card or mobile wallet.
